Pavers Around Fire Pit Lee County FL
Building a secure and attractive area around your fire pit is essential, and using pavers is the ideal solution. A ring of pavers around your fire pit creates a non-combustible zone, greatly improving safety by blocking sparks from touching your lawn or other combustible surfaces. This "spark arrestor" zone should preferably extend at least about 3–4 feet from the fire pit's edge. More than just safety, pavers offer a durable flooring for chairs and tables, removing the problem of unstable furniture on uneven grass. This functional foundation ensures your fire pit area is not only protected but also comfortable and inviting for you and your guests to relax for long periods.

Building A Fire Pit With Pavers Lee County FL
Building a fire pit with pavers is a fulfilling DIY project that can redefine your backyard. The process begins with a sturdy base. You'll need to prepare a round or rectangular area, lay a compact base of gravel for water runoff, and top it with a layer of fine sand. The first course of pavers is the most important; it must be perfectly level. Once the base is prepared, you can stack the subsequent layers of wall pavers, securing them with a strong outdoor-grade adhesive between each course. For strength and reliability, it's highly recommended to place a metal liner. This protects the paver blocks from direct, intense heat, stopping heat damage over time.

Fire Pit Using Pavers Lee County FL
Constructing a fire feature built with pavers offers a wide range of design options and a polished, high-end finish. The key is to select the right type of pavers—specifically, heavy-duty concrete blocks, which are designed for stacking. Basic slab pavers used for patios are inappropriate for forming the perimeter of a stone fire ring. When picking the right stones, choose tapered designs if you want to create a circular fire pit, as these align perfectly to build a smooth curve. Using a specialized heat-resistant bonding agent between each layer will guarantee your stone fire feature is a solid, safe, and durable structure for many years of enjoyment.

- Base Excavation and Compaction: Excavate 6-8 inches and lay your aggregate base. The critical step here is compacting the base in 2-inch lifts until you achieve a minimum of 95% proctor density. I use a hand tamper for small projects and a plate compactor for larger ones. This prevents the sinking that causes most long-term failures.
- The First Course Dry-Fit: Using your recalculated diameter, draw a perfect circle on your compacted base. Lay your first course of pavers directly on the line *without adhesive*. This is your single opportunity to confirm your calculations. The pavers should fit snugly with near-zero gaps on the inner faces.
- Leveling the First Course: This is the most important mechanical step. Using a 4-foot level, ensure the first course is perfectly level across every single paver and from one side of the ring to the other. An error of 1/8th of an inch on the first course can become a full inch by the top.
- Stacking and Adhesion: Once the first course is perfect, you can begin stacking. Apply a high-temperature masonry adhesive in a continuous bead. Do not spot-apply the glue, as this creates pressure points. Stagger the joints between courses for maximum structural bond.
- Cap and Finish: Install the capstones, typically with a slight overhang. This is more for aesthetics and to protect the main structure from rainfall. Ensure the cap is also perfectly level.
